    GlaxoSmithKline plc (GSK) is a British multinational pharmaceutical, biologics, vaccines and consumer healthcare company which has its headquarters in Brentford, London. As of March 2014, it was the world's sixth-largest pharmaceutical company after Johnson & Johnson, Novartis, Hoffmann-La Roche, Pfizer, and Sanofi, measured by 2013 revenue. The company ...

    Production Shift Manager

    Ref No: 141022-2
    Location: Agbara
    Reporting To: Packaging Manager

    Job Purpose/Scope

    •     To provide overall direction to production scheduling, dispensing, manufacturing and packaging team in a value stream concept in (Over the Counter) OTC value stream
    •     To be responsible for the effective management of all activities/functions related to production process/equipment validation, production equipment calibration and new process installation and transfer

    Key Responsibilities

    •     Ensure the generation and effective treatment of Picklist, Batch records and Work Orders
    •     Control product cost through effective labor utilization and pragmatic equipment and facilities management
    •     Supervise the disposal of all controlled substance / drugs in line with existing regulations
    •     Actively participate in all production activities involved in New Product Introduction, New Packaging Material Development and New Process Installation
    •     Coordinate all manufacturing and packaging process / equipment validation in accordance with Validation Master Plan. This includes data generation, collation and logical interpretation
    •     Ensure timely calibration of all production equipment and ensure appropriate actions are taken on out of order equipment
    •     Provide effective technical training to all production personnel on technical aspects of manufacturing and GMP
    •     Regularly review and/or update SOPs to reflect current practices within the production areas
    •     Support and ensure compliance to QMS and EHS policies and standards in order to minimize accidents and quality failures

    Qualifications, Experience

    •     Minimum of Bachelor's degree in Pharmacy with not less than three (3) years of working experience in Pharmaceutical Manufacturing, Research & Development or Quality Assurance preferably in a multinational environment
    •     Sound Knowledge of statistical tools, numerate skills, good logic and good interpersonal relationship are a must for the job holder
    •     Second degree in Pharmaceutics or Pharmaceutical Chemistry, as well as Computer Literacy will be a clear advantage

    Competencies

    •     Ability to plan and organize production processes
    •     Relevant production knowledge and management skills in a pharmaceutical setting
    •     Performance and result-oriented with sound leadership qualities for effective supervision
    •     Excellent communication skills
    •     Good initiative, drive & confidence in problem solving
    •     Leadership and team building
    •     Ability to apply Operational Excellence principles of Process Management and Lean Manufacturing
